Output d3191bc59b51587356c001754046384f72222064ff3bb16473be4dd661541788:5

value
123661066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ccdf765dbdc8d7241ca2084a155a5dcfc89fb7 OP_EQUAL
address
MFdYRMyyJaTK3gc8i6Zd4u4e99d8Nf1xQx
transaction
d3191bc59b51587356c001754046384f72222064ff3bb16473be4dd661541788
spent
true